* This event is fired on both sides whenever the player right clicks while targeting a block. <br>
* This event controls which of {@link Item#onItemUseFirst}, {@link Block#onBlockActivated}, and {@link Item#onItemUse}
* will be called. <br>
* Canceling the event will cause none of the above three to be called. <br>
* <br>
* Let result be the first non-pass return value of the above three methods, or pass, if they all pass. <br>
* Or {@link #cancellationResult} if the event is cancelled. <br>
* If result equals {@link ActionResultType#PASS}, we proceed to {@link RightClickItem}. <br>
* <br>
* There are various results to this event, see the getters below. <br>
* Note that handling things differently on the client vs server may cause desynchronizations!
*/

/**
* DENY: {@link Block#onBlockActivated} will never be called. <br>
* DEFAULT: {@link Block#onBlockActivated} will be called if {@link Item#onItemUseFirst} passes. <br>
* Note that default activation can be blocked if the user is sneaking and holding an item that does not return true to {@link Item#doesSneakBypassUse}. <br>
* ALLOW: {@link Block#onBlockActivated} will always be called, unless {@link Item#onItemUseFirst} does not pass. <br>
*/
